The purpose of TMHA is to serve its membership while simultaneously promoting the general welfare and interest of the manufactured housing industry throughout the state of Texas. TMHA is composed of professionals committed to successfully representing the interests of our members and the Texas manufactured housing industry, particularly on a state level by providing dedicated representation in the Texas Legislature. As a membership-based association, TMHA is also focused on supplying our 1,400+ members with the information and resources necessary to conduct a successful business through various membership benefits. For 57 years, the Texas Manufactured Housing Association has served Texas’ manufactured housing industry. Formed June 19, 1952 as a non-profit trade association, TMHA has remained dedicated to serving its membership and the growing demand for affordable housing in the wake of World War II. Today, TMHA is concerned with the entire scope of the Texas manufactured housing industry. The association represents over 1,400 members from every facet of the industry, including: manufacturers, retailers, communities, insurance companies, suppliers of goods and services, sales people, real estate companies, title companies, developers, transporters, installers, financial institutions, brokers and other affiliated companies

Two Capitols Consulting is a full-service government affairs firm focused on helping clients achieve success both in Washington, DC and Virginia. With significant experience both on Capitol Hill and in the halls of Mr. Jefferson’s state capitol in Richmond, Two Capitols Consulting principals are ready to work with your company, trade association or non-profit to develop and execute successful government strategies. The bipartisan team at Two Capitols Consulting is well versed in federal and state policy and has a successful track record in advising clients on how to effectively interpret, navigate and impact federal and state policy. Whether your needs are focused on creating state and federal public policy agendas, drafting legislation, lobbying the Virginia General Assembly or Congress, navigating complex federal and state regulations, or staying abreast of state and federal political matters, Two Capitols Consulting provides companies of any size with strategic advice and strong representation at all levels of government.

Nagios XI versions prior to 2026R1.1 are vulnerable to local privilege escalation due to an unsafe interaction between sudo permissions and application file permissions. A user‑accessible maintenance script may be executed as root via sudo and includes an application file that is writable by a lower‑privileged user. A local attacker with access to the application account can modify this file to introduce malicious code, which is then executed with elevated privileges when the script is run. Successful exploitation results in arbitrary code execution as the root user.

SIPGO is a library for writing SIP services in the GO language. Starting in version 0.3.0 and prior to version 1.0.0-alpha-1, a nil pointer dereference vulnerability is in the SIPGO library's `NewResponseFromRequest` function that affects all normal SIP operations. The vulnerability allows remote attackers to crash any SIP application by sending a single malformed SIP request without a To header. The vulnerability occurs when SIP message parsing succeeds for a request missing the To header, but the response creation code assumes the To header exists without proper nil checks. This affects routine operations like call setup, authentication, and message handling - not just error cases. This vulnerability affects all SIP applications using the sipgo library, not just specific configurations or edge cases, as long as they make use of the `NewResponseFromRequest` function. Version 1.0.0-alpha-1 contains a patch for the issue.

GLPI is a free asset and IT management software package. Starting in version 9.1.0 and prior to version 10.0.21, an unauthorized user with an API access can read all knowledge base entries. Users should upgrade to 10.0.21 to receive a patch.
